Conditions Award means the NSW Universities General Staff (Conditions of Employment) Award, as incorporated into the Higher Education General and Salaried Staff (Interim) Award, 1989. ‘Consultation’ means a process in which the parties exchange information about a matter or issue, hold discussions to explain points of view and take into account the views of the parties. Consultation does not necessarily mean that agreement will be reached. If agreement is not reached, reasons will be given. ‘Continuous employment’ means a period of employment under an unbroken contract of employment (or an unbroken series of contiguous contracts) with the University including periods of paid and unpaid leave. Under this Agreement, continuous employment includes breaks in service of up to two months for the purpose of qualifying for long service leave, and may include up to three months in certain circumstances for the purpose of calculating years of service for redundancy severance payments. In the case of Research Only staff, continuous employment includes breaks in service of up to six months for the purpose of qualifying for long service leave. In all circumstances, the period of the break will not be counted as service. ‘Delegated Officer’ means the substantive, temporary or acting occupant of a position which has delegated authority from the University’s Delegations of Authority document.
